Kuala Trengganu Selatan
Kuala Trengganu Selatan was a federal constituency in Terengganu, Malaysia, that was represented in the Dewan Rakyat from 1959 to 1974.

Representation history
| Members of Parliament for Kuala Trengganu Selatan | |||
|---|---|---|---|
| Parliament | Years | Member | Party |
| Constituency created from Terengganu Tengah | |||
| Parliament of the Federation of Malaya | |||
| 1st | 1959-1962 | Onn Jaafar (عون جعفر) | Parti Negara |
| 1962-1963 | Ismail Kassim (اسماعيل كسسيم) | Alliance (UMNO) | |
| Parliament of Malaysia | |||
| 1st | 1963-1964 | Ismail Kassim (اسماعيل كسسيم) | Alliance (UMNO) |
| 2nd | 1964-1969 | Abdullah Abdul Rahman (عبدالله عبدالرحمن) | |
| 1969-1971 | Parliament was suspended[1][2] | ||
| 3rd | 1971-1973 | Mohd. Daud Abdul Samad(محمد. داود عبدالصمد) | PMIP |
| 1973-1974 | BN (PMIP) | ||
| Constituency abolished, split into Kuala Nerus and Kuala Trengganu | |||
